ICD-9-CMThis code signifies the presence of a blood clot (thrombus) within a vein, leading to an obstruction of blood flow, where the specific location of the embolism or thrombosis is not documented or is unknown. It represents a general diagnosis of venous thromboembolism without anatomical specificity.
Use this code when documentation confirms a venous embolism or thrombosis but lacks details regarding the affected vessel or anatomical site. This is appropriate for cases where the physician states "venous thrombosis, unspecified" or "venous embolism, site unknown."
